Largest Available Parkton and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Parkton, MD is found at Cardiff Charles Apartments in the Regents Club At Falls Croft neighborhood and is 1,100 square feet priced from $1,495. Charlesgate Apartments has the second largest 1 Bedroom, which is sized at 995 square feet and currently listed start at $1,749. Here is today’s list of the largest available 1 Bedroom units in Parkton:

Cheapest Available Parkton and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of July 26, 2026 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Parkton, MD is the One bedroom Model starting from $1,162 at The Lakes Apartments and Townhomes in the Cockeysville neighborhood. The second most affordable Parkton 1 Bedroom is the One Bedroom - 805 sqft Model at The Village of Chartleytowne Apartments and Townhomes starting at $1,170 in the The Estates/Fields of Sagamore neighborhood.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Parkton is currently $1,587.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Parkton:

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Parkton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Parkton with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Parkton is at The Lakes Apartments and Townhomes listed at $1,162.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Parkton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Parkton is $1,587.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Parkton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Parkton is a 1,100 square feet unit starting from $1,495 at Cardiff Charles Apartments.

What is the average size for Parkton 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Parkton is currently 801 sq ft.
